[Cloud Monitoring #01] Terminus로 SSH 접속하기

이석환·2023년 10월 10일

Cloud Monitoring

목록 보기
2/5
post-thumbnail

종합 프로젝트 수업을 진행하며 학습한 내용을 정리하는 글입니다.

기존에 ssh를 접속할 때는 터미널을 통해 접속하였는데, 사실 예쁜 GUI랑 편리하게 접근하고 관리하고 싶어서 플랫폼을 찾아보다가 Terminus라는 걸 발견하였다.
이번 포스팅은 간단하지만 Terminus를 사용하여 SSH에 접속하는 방법을 기술하고자 한다.

1. Terminus

Get instant access to your whole infrastructure

  • Stop wasting time by searching and re-entering IP addresses, ports, usernames, and passwords. Instead, connect to your remote devices with only one click.

특징

  • Save your hosts to connect in one click

Set connection information, credentials, and even terminal appearance to a Host to connect with the same one-click experience across all the platforms.
호스트에 연결하기 위한 연결 정보, 자격 증명 및 터미널을 설정하여 모든 플랫폼에서 동일한 원클릭으로 접근

  • Secure your data with a Cloud Vault

Keep your data safe in an encrypted vault that is only accessible from your devices.
Create multiple shared vaults to securely share connections with your team.
암호화된 클라우드 보관소에 데이터를 안전하게 보관하여 팀 간의 기기에서만 접근할 수 있도록 보호

  • AI-powered autocomplete

Simply type your command description, and our autocomplete will transform it into a bash command. Effortless, efficient, and ready to boost your terminal experience.
명령어 설명을 입력하면 자동 완성이 해당 명령어를 bash 명령어로 변환 -> 효율성 증가

  • Share your terminal sessions

Join your teammates in a terminal session to troubleshoot together or teach new terminal tricks.
No server-side installation is required!
서버 설치가 필요하지 않다.

  • Automate routine tasks

Save your frequently used shell scripts as Snippets. Run them on multiple targets or instantly get them autocompleted right in the terminal.
Share your Snippets with your team to boost its productivity and reduce the number of mistypes.
자주 사용하는쉘 스크립트를 스니펫으로 저장 -> 여러 대상에서 실행하거나 터미널에서 자동 완성으로 빠르게 실행

Terminus Homepage에서 발췌해온 내용인데 이러한 장점들이 있다.
난 예쁜 터미널과 큰 화면 그리고 간편한 접근에 매력을 느껴 사용했다.

2. 접속 방법


실행 시 위와 같은 화면이다.
나는 이미 4개의 인스턴스를 구동하고 있어서 위와 같이 표시되지만 처음 사용하면 아무 것도 뜨지 않는다.

[Cloud Monitoring #00] NHN Cloud에서 나는 Instance를 생성했었다.
NHN Cloud Console에서는 매우 편리하게 사용자에게 접속하는 방법을 알려준다.

(팀원들의 동의를 구하지 않아서 모두 모자이크 처리)
접속 정보를 누른 후 밑에 명령어를 복사한다.

위와 같이 붙여넣기를 한 다음 CONNECT를 누른다.


만약 이렇게 빙글빙글 돈다면 보안그룹이 설정이 안 된 것이다.
본인의 클라우드 서비스로 돌아가 port 22를 열어주자 !


본인이 인스턴스 생성시에 발급받은 키페어를 넣어준다.
여기서 왜 로컬에 잘 저장하라고 한 것인지 유추했을 것이라 믿는다.
그리고 Continue & Save를 누르면 끝 !

3. 접속

위와 같이 엄청나게 예쁜 UI와 다양한 터미널 테마가 보이는가 ?

추가로 호스트 이름이나 관련 설정을 바꾸고 싶다면 Hosts를 누르고 연필 모양을 클릭 후 우측에서 바꿀 수 있다.
필자는 간단하게 다음 장에서 Prometheus 설치를 할 것이라 InstallPrometheus로 바꾸었다.
뭔가 개발을 더 잘할 수 있을 것 같다.

Reference
https://termius.com
https://www.nhncloud.com/kr

profile
반갑습니다.

2개의 댓글

comment-user-thumbnail
2023년 10월 12일

Hi, I am taegon.
I am interested in your project.
Thank you.

1개의 답글